Output 4fcb607214ec43dbffc8d59f2a2f9a419d014b6136b02e18aa6bcd2ac81573ea:0

value
311028
script pubkey
OP_0 OP_PUSHBYTES_20 1238205761c74b9ce2b43f57812b7a90542055c9
address
bc1qzguzq4mpca9eec458atcz2m6jp2zq4wfmgrgvu
transaction
4fcb607214ec43dbffc8d59f2a2f9a419d014b6136b02e18aa6bcd2ac81573ea
confirmations
357278
spent
true